Output ef7f2e90fb3fac0d060cd7368f1c91616abf18a3603b5e8d042cb5326a407936:0

value
1454422116
script pubkey
OP_0 OP_PUSHBYTES_20 e17ddfc41a98993bf6d2fe8a302cf9895f579c6c
address
bc1qu97al3q6nzvnhakjl69rqt8e390408rv454pyx
transaction
ef7f2e90fb3fac0d060cd7368f1c91616abf18a3603b5e8d042cb5326a407936
spent
true